Production method of heat-insulating layer material for plastic pipes
A technology for plastic pipes and production methods, which is applied in the field of polyurethane material processing, can solve the problems of poor material performance such as thermal insulation and strength, and achieve the effects of easy promotion, simple process, and good mechanical quality

Embodiment 1
[0028] A method for manufacturing an insulating layer material for plastic pipes includes the following steps:
[0029] (1) Preparation of strengthening additives:
[0030] a. Put the attapulgite clay into the calcining furnace for high-temperature calcination, take it out after 1h, and then dry it for use after pickling, alkali washing, and deionized water washing;
[0031] b. Put the attapulgite treated by operation a into the electron beam irradiation box for irradiation treatment, and take it out after 10 minutes for use;
[0032] c. Put the soybean starch into a drying box for 2 hours, then mix it with anhydrous dimethyl sulfoxide in a weight-to-volume ratio of 1g:10ml and put it into the mixing tank, stir and dissolve to obtain mixed solution A spare;
[0033] d. Mix polycaprolactone and anhydrous dimethyl sulfoxide according to a weight-to-volume ratio of 1g:13ml and put them into a mixing tank, stir and dissolve to obtain mixed solution B for use;
